With this combination of attachments, you could have either an S380-37 or S385-37 channel balance. You’ll need to measure as shown below. The Series 380 has a 1" bottom attachment, and the Series 385 has a 1-3/32" attachment. Your stamp is a bit unusual, however. You'll need to weigh your sash to determine the appropriate spring strength option. There's a chart on the S380-37 and S385-37 store pages that will show you which option you'll need based on the weight of your sash.  

As for the top sash guide, yours looks like a match for the 18-161 but compare our dimensions to yours to see if you agree.

You're correct; we can indeed custom make your balance with the 19-005 winged top and 15-029 bottom shoe. Choosing a stronger option would actually make the window harder to close, not easier. With that said, the stamp option will be 3640 for a sash weighing 23 to 30 lbs.
